Convert the following readings of pressure to kPa, assuming that the barometer reads 760 mmHg:

(a) 90 cm Hg gauge

(b) 40 cm Hg vacuum

(c) 1.2 m H2O gauge

(d) 3.1 bar

760 mm Hg = 0.760 × 13600 × 9.81 Pa

= 10139.16 Pa

= 101.4 kPa

(a) 90 cm Hg gauge 

= 0.90 × 13600 × 9.81 × 10-3 + 101.4 kPa

= 221.4744 kPa

(b) 40 cm Hg vacuum

= (76 – 40) cm (absolute)

= 0.36 × 43.600 × 9.81 kPa

= 48.03 kPa

(c) 1.2 m H2O gauge

= 1.2 × 1000 × 9.81 × 10-3 + 101.4 kPa

= 113.172 kPa

(d) 3.1 bar

= 3.1 × 100 kPa

= 310 kPa
